Party Time

18th December 2018Clare Downey

Yesterday we had a wonderful day at our Christmas party. In the morning we went into the School Hall with our friends from KS1 where we joined in with lots of party games such as Christmas corners, musical statues and musical bumps. We went back to class for a quick snack and then we went back into the Hall to sing Christmas songs with different props.

In the afternoon we sang beautiful songs around the smart board “fire” whilst we waited for a special visitor, Santa Claus himself. We sat around the Christmas tree and Santa gave us each a present. We then enjoyed some yummy food. What a busy day.

Somewhere only we know…

18th December 2018Loveday Fisk

On Friday, all of us at Hadrian showcased our fantastic Christmas performance.

Class 5/6 would like to say a huge well done to all of the children and all involved for the hard work that went into making the show so magical.

Our class joined forces with Johns class, and together we produced a video of the children having lots of fun in a ‘Winter Wonderland’ to the ever so popular song ‘Somewhere only we know’. The video really captures how fantastic our children are, and we are very proud of each and everyone of them. The performance on Friday went smoothly, and they all stayed calm and happy from start to finish. Even showing lovely smiles on stage!

Fantastic app to make days out easier

14th December 2018Elaine Quinn

The HOOP – never be lost for ideas of things to do again with this handy app.  The choice is amazing!

Hoop has all the information you need to have a fun day out, such as the ages of children that can attend an event, pricing and booking information, travel times and more.

It has filters that help you tailor your preferences when looking for fun that won’t break the bank. How about something to do in the evening after school? Or what about an activity that is just a short walk from home? Hoop has powerful filters that help you find the right activity given any situation you might find yourself in.

You can compare ratings and read reviews from other parents before you go.
You can also find out what their children thought of the activity and get top tips and information in advance. You can also share your own experiences by submitting a review for organisers listed on Hoop.

Even better you can book your spot in just a few taps!

Pop Up Hair Shop !

14th December 2018Elaine Quinn

What a fantastic day we had in our pop up salon !

The response was amazing and the kids absolutely loved it as you can see by the pics! There are some many lovely pictures.

Thanks to everyone who sent in a voluntary contribution of £3. We have raised £95 so far, and this will go to school funds to buy new equipment and resources.

We are now going to run it once a term and the next date is Friday 8th February.  A letter will come out nearer the time.
